Project Overview:

Our client's Consumer Shopping team focuses on user needs at that moment when shoppers start or continue their shopping journey. Think about the last time that you were serendipitously motivated to start shopping - perhaps you saw someone on the subway wearing an awesome pair of sneakers or you were reminded that you needed plant food while you were watching a video. Our vision is to support and inspire users to start and resume their shopping journeys on their favorite products.

Overall Responsibilities:

This senior role will help shape the design and future of shopping on our client's platform by shining a light on user behavior, needs, and opportunities. Research projects range from foundational to evaluative studies.

Top 3 Daily Responsibilities:Design/conduct studies based on a solid understanding of strengths and shortcomings of different research methods, including when and how to apply them during each product phase.Partner with cross-functional team members and other UX Researchers as you plan and execute your studies, ensuring your research aligns with top priorities.Articulate key insights through clear and comprehensive written reports, compelling visuals, frameworks, decks, and documentary style video clips. Present findings to a diverse audience, including senior leaders.Skill/Experience/Education:

Portfolio: Must share a portfolio demonstrating strong breadth and depth of UX Research experience, including qualitative foundational research (e.g., diary studies, ethnographic studies) and quantitative research (e.g., surveys)Education: A bachelor's or master's degree in a research-focused field and/or sufficient experience to demonstrate qualifications for the responsibilities aboveYears experience: 5+ years industry experience conducting user research in a professional context and has worked directly with users (e.g., lab studies, field studies, surveys, competitive analyses) and cross-functional partners (e.g., PMs, engineers, data science, marketing)Skills or processes:

Extensive experience running a variety of UXR methodologies (e.g., diary studies, ethnographic studies, surveys, usability studies). They must have owned the entire UXR process independently (from defining research questions to presenting to stakeholders)Very strong writing skills (comfortable articulating insights in a document)Experience working within a product development cycle with PMs, engineers, marketing, data scienceThe target hiring compensation range for this role is the equivalent of $63 to $70 an hour.
